Comparing Health Insurance Plans: Finding the Best Fit

Navigating the world of health insurance can feel overwhelming , but taking the ideal choice for you and your dependents is vital for financial stability . Thoroughly comparing different policies involves evaluating key elements . Consider the periodic premium – this is what you'll pay each period . Next, examine the amount – the amount you must pay before your insurance starts to cover medical costs . Then, assess the provider list of specialists – make sure your preferred health specialists are included . Finally, remember that lower premiums often signify larger deductibles and restricted advantages .
